The ingredients needed to make Shiitake Mushrooms Baked With Miso and Mayonnaise:
  1. Make ready 6 Shiitake mushrooms
  2. Take 2 tbsp ● Mayonnaise
  3. Get 1 tsp ● Miso
  4. Get 1/2 tsp ● Sugar
  5. Prepare 1 small clove ● Grated garlic
  6. Make ready 1 stalk ● Green onion
  7. Prepare 1 all of it ● The stems of the shiitake mushrooms, finely chopped
  8. Make ready 1 ● Black pepper
  9. Prepare 1 dash bit White sesame seeds
Steps to make Shiitake Mushrooms Baked With Miso and Mayonnaise:
  1. Mix all the ● ingredients together.
  2. Spread inside the shiitake mushroom caps. Sprinkle with sesame seeds, and just bake in an oven!!
  3. The miso-mayonnaise is delicious on chicken, white fish, or shrimp. Try adding some pizza cheese.
